Budget

The dress is one of the most important elements of your wedding day, but it could also be the most expensive. That's why it's crucial to establish the budget for your wedding dress before you start shopping. Fortunately, there are ways to save on your dress without having to compromise on design or quality. You can find a dress that fits your budget by keeping your style simple and shopping during sales.

The fabric of your dress plays a an important role in how much it will cost. Designer fabrics like satin, silk and lace are more expensive than synthetic or blended fabrics. Intricate details such as beading and embroidery, or the lace appliques can also add cost since they require additional work.

Another important thing to consider when setting a dress-cost budget is that any modifications will increase the overall cost of your gown. A skilled seamstress can alter your dress to fit your body perfectly however it will cost money. Alterations can range from $100 to $500, based on the amount of work needed.

Budget for catering, transportation, videography and invitations, in addition to the dress. You'll also have to budget for the cost of a second dress that many brides prefer to wear to the reception or after-party.

Don't forget to add other expenses related to your dress, like a hair accessory or a veil. Asking friends and family for assistance can be a good option if you are struggling to find a dress that fits within your budget. This is an excellent method to be a part of the excitement of finding that perfect dress while being able to pay for other wedding-related expenses.

The average wedding dress is priced at around $1000. However prices can vary depending on the designer, fabric, and other details. There are also a number of ways to cut costs on your dress without compromising style or quality, including buying a dress off the rack or choosing a nontraditional bridal choice, such as white evening gowns available at department stores such as Nordstrom or Mac Duggal.

Alterations

When you have found the perfect wedding dress, it might require some adjustments to make it fit perfectly. A tailor, seamstress, or a bridal salon that specializes in wedding dresses can assist you in this. Alterations can be pricey and therefore it's a good idea to include them in your overall dress budget.

A few common modifications include adding sleeves or straps, or bringing in the waist or hips. These changes make the dress more comfortable to wear on your wedding day, and in everyday life.

Many brides also add details such as lace, beads fringe, buttons, or lace. These are usually easy to create and can be completed quickly. However, if you want to add a more complicated feature (like a veil) it will take much longer to complete.

Ask the tailor to sew your dress so that it isn't too high and barely touches the ground. This will let you walk or dance with your guests without worrying about tripping. It is much easier to remove fabric than to add it, so don't be afraid to voice your concerns when you feel that the dress is too long.

Another option is to have the waistline wider. It's a complicated and time-consuming process, but a talented tailor can make it look stunning and ensure that you have plenty of breathing space while wearing the dress.

Bring your shoes and any undergarments that you plan to wear on your wedding day you to your appointment for modifications. This includes dress-up clothes, Spanx, and bras that fit properly. These items can make an enormous difference in how your dress fits and can help you visualize what your final gown looks like.
